MB Crusher is a world-leading manufacturer of crusher and screening attachments for excavators, loaders, skid steers and backhoe loaders. Their patented bucket crusher technology allows operators to crush, screen, sort and process materials directly on site — eliminating the need to transport waste to off-site processing plants. On-site material processing with MB Crusher attachments delivers significant cost and time savings. Instead of loading demolition rubble, broken concrete and rock into trucks for off-site crushing, operators can crush the material on the spot and immediately reuse it as backfill, road base, building rubble fill or aggregate — cutting truck movements, tipping fees and material purchase costs. The MB BF range of bucket crushers connects to the existing hydraulic system of excavators from 6 to 150 tonnes. The crushing jaw is driven by the excavator's hydraulic flow, so no additional power source is required. Material is fed through the bucket opening and exits the bottom as crushed aggregate of a size determined by the adjustable jaw gap. MB Crusher screening buckets (the MB-S range) sort and screen materials without crushing them. These attachments are used for reclaiming topsoil, screening gravel, separating aggregate by size and cleaning contaminated soil — all tasks that would otherwise require a standalone screening plant. Drum cutters (the MB-R range) are rotary cutting heads for excavators, suited to rock profiling, trench cutting and concrete milling in areas where impact hammers cannot be used due to vibration restrictions near structures or utilities. Which excavator sizes are MB Crusher attachments compatible with?MB Crusher bucket crushers are available for excavators from 6 to 150 tonnes. Screening buckets, drum cutters and grapples cover a similar weight range. MCM Group will confirm the correct model for your specific excavator make, model and hydraulic capacity.

Can MB Crusher attachments be used on loaders and skid steers, not just excavators?Yes. Many MB Crusher attachments — including screening buckets, sorting grapples and smaller bucket crushers — are available in versions compatible with loaders, backhoe loaders and skid steers.
